  • the invention relates to a smoking tobacco for the self-manufacture of cigarettes, in particular using prefabricated cigarette paper tubes, consisting of one or more tobacco portion (s), each comprising at least two partial quantities, held together by internal / external fixing means, each partial quantity being approximately that for a cigarette contains the required quantity of tobacco, and wherein the outer surface of the tobacco portion and / or the partial quantities is so permeable to air that it is not draftable as such and is therefore not smokable.
  • the invention further relates to a packaging for such a smoking tobacco and a method for its production.
  • a smoking tobacco consisting of a quantity of the smoking tobacco forming a sales unit in the form of approximately equal portions, the smoking tobacco being wholly or at least partially wrapped is held together from completely smokable material.
  • each subset is approximately round rod-shaped.
  • Each subset corresponds approximately to the amount of tobacco required for a cigarette.
  • the casing of the known smoking tobacco consists of non-tractive, perforated or mesh-like material.
  • the known smoking tobacco is divided into round-rod-like subsets by pressing, creasing, punching, perforating, cutting, inserted threads or the like.
  • the subsets are strung together so that they can be easily detached from one another without, however, the individual subsets being destroyed or without the internal cohesion of the individual subsets being lost as a result.
  • the known smoking tobacco can at least in places also contain a fixative for increasing the internal cohesion of each subset.
  • the known smoking tobacco should be able to make a cigarette from special non-smokable material and transfer device without special aids, such as auxiliary packaging.
  • a smoking tobacco of the known type in which rod-like portions can be separated without destroying them for self-production of cigarettes by wrapping them with cigarette paper, is taxed in exactly the same way as cigarettes.
  • the system according to DE-U 8 326 921 and 8 309 186 represents an interim solution between the last-mentioned conventional methods and the system according to DE-C-34 07 461 and EP-B-155 514.
  • This system is characterized by a non-smokable prefabricated product in the form of a prefabricated tobacco cartridge consisting of an open-ended strand casing with the diameter of the cigarette paper sleeve of the finished cigarette and a strand-like tobacco filling, each corresponding to a cigarette portion, which consists of an associated piston which is adapted to the inside diameter of the casing the strand envelope can be transferred into an empty cigarette paper tube.
  • This tobacco product is suitable for use in connection with conventional self-tapping cigarette paper tubes as well as in paper tubes with conventional self-rolling cigarette paper papers.
  • the consumer is provided with a precisely metered quantity of tobacco in the form of a cigarette tobacco cartridge, which corresponds to the filling quantity of a conventional industrial consumer cigarette, the tobacco filling of which in a relatively simple manner in a prefabricated cigarette paper tube of a commercially available type or in a self-made Rolled cigarette paper cigarette paper sleeve is transferable.
  • the tobacco cartridge has an envelope, namely a strand envelope, which consists of non-smokable material.
  • this strand casing represents a superfluous auxiliary device that can only be used once.
  • the present invention has for its object to provide a smoking tobacco that has all the advantages of pre-portioned tobacco subsets for the self-manufacture of cigarettes and the advantage of tax privilege even in the countries where rod-shaped tobacco portions are not smokable per se, but after being wrapped with cigarette paper they become smokable, like cigarettes are taxed.
  • the waste i.e. aids not suitable for smoking must be reduced to a minimum.
  • Claims 21 and 22 show preferred methods for self-manufacturing cigarettes using a smoking tobacco according to one or more of Claims 1 to 13.
  • the core of the smoking tobacco designed according to the invention lies in the formation of the tobacco portion comprising two or more subsets in the form of a tobacco cuboid such that each subsection has a tobacco rod with an approximately triangular or polygonal, in particular rectangular, preferably square cross-section, and a length corresponding to the length of the The tobacco receiving room of the cigarette to be manufactured.
  • the shape of the subsets is such that they cannot easily be transferred into a conventional cigarette paper tube to produce a smokable, ie tractive, cigarette. Rather, each subset, at least in terms of its cross section, must be shaped before being transferred to a prefabricated cigarette paper tube. This is preferably done within the press chamber of a conventional cigarette tamping device, with which the portion can be transferred into a prepared cigarette paper tube.
  • the predetermined shape of the partial quantity must be changed, in particular resolved.
  • the partial quantity is preferably first positioned on a rolling paper, in order to be loosened or crumbled with the fingers before being wrapped with the rolling paper.
  • each sub-quantity can be kneaded with a finger in the form of a tobacco rod with an approximately circular cross-section before being wrapped with a rolling paper.
  • the smoking tobacco designed according to the invention or the partial quantities separated therefrom represent a special type of pre-portioned fine-cut quantities.
  • the tobacco is preferably pressed in such a way that it has a tensile resistance approximately corresponding to the tensile resistance of the tobacco filling of a conventional cigarette.
  • This also ensures that the tobacco is sufficiently dimensionally stable, in particular each subset even after separation from the tobacco block according to the invention.
  • Such a partial quantity can thus be transferred after being separated from the tobacco cuboid into the press chamber of a conventional tamping device or onto a prepared, that is to say spread out, cigarette paper sheet.

  • the tobacco cuboid according to the invention can be produced in that a tobacco rod with an approximately rectangular cross section is guided continuously or intermittently past a tobacco separating device comprising a plurality of spaced-apart cutting or punching elements, by means of which the tobacco rod is divided into individual partial strands which are preferably still connected to one another on the side facing away from the cutting elements, and then the partial strands are passed through a crosswise to the conveying direction effective knife or the like. Cutting device are separated from the tobacco rod.
  • the cutting or punching elements can alternatively act on the upper, lower or both flat sides of the tobacco rod.
  • a tobacco connecting web can be formed between adjacent partial strands halfway up the tobacco strand.
  • separating webs made of cardboard or the like can be inserted into the separating cuts between the adjacent partial strands, which are either already cut to a partial length or cut together with the partial lengths to a partial length.

  • a tobacco rod 22 with an approximately rectangular cross section is guided continuously or intermittently past a tobacco separating device 24 comprising a plurality of cutting or punching elements (circular knives 23) arranged at a distance apart (conveying direction arrow 25).
  • the cutting elements are rotary-driven circular knives 23, the depth of cut T of which can be adjusted by correspondingly displacing the axis of rotation 25 relative to the tobacco rod 22 (see double arrow 26).
  • the circular knife 23 is continuously re-sharpened by grinding disks 28 acting on both sides of the cutting edge 27.
  • the circular knives 23 are arranged opposite a pressing device 29, which is effective against the cut of the circular knives 23.
  • the circular knives 23 are each followed by a separating device in the form of split wedges or split plates 30 penetrating into the separating cuts, so that the tobacco remains separated in the area of the separating cuts.
  • the tobacco rod is divided into partial strands by the circular knives 23. Subsequently, the partial strands are separated from the tobacco strand 22 by a knife (not shown in FIG. 9) that is effective transversely to the conveying direction 25. Then the tobacco cuboids thus obtained and their packaging are separated.

  • each tobacco cuboid comprises at least two, preferably six to ten, subsets.
  • the tobacco mixture is produced in such a way that the individual portions give a taste when smoking which corresponds to that of a conventional factory-made cigarette. Above all, it is ensured that each cigarette tastes equally by pre-portioning the tobacco. The same applies to smoking or draft behavior and the smoke constituents.
  • the tobacco can be compressed more or less tightly within the tobacco cuboid or the partial quantities and / or mixed with more or less internal fixing agents or binders.
  • Each portion should preferably contain about 0.6 to 1.2 g of tobacco.
